Best time to go to Dromara

The best time to visit Dromara can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Dromara fal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Dromara fal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.1°F (4.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
March42.4°F (5.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
April46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
May50.7°F (10.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ly High
June56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
December41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Dromara

To reach Dromara, tourists can fly into two major airports. George Best Belfast City Airport (BHD) is located 27.4km away, with nearby accommodation options such as The Fitzwilliam Hotel Belfast and The Merchant Hotel, both five-star establishments, situated within 4.8km of the airport. Belfast International Airport (BFS) is 33.8km from Dromara, offering convenient stays at the four-star Doubletree by Hilton Belfast Templepatrick, 9.7km away, and Dunadry Hotel and Gardens, 6.4km away. What's the weather like in Dromara?

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Dromara is 1018 mm.
